Lien Notice Before Recording
Enforcement requirement under Florida law — Fla. Stat. § 720.3085
Statutory Citation
Fla. Stat. § 720.3085
Effective 2023-01-01 · Florida
Category
Enforcement
Outlines required procedures before imposing fines, liens, or other enforcement actions.
Required Notice Period
45 days
Minimum advance notice required by statute
What this statute requires
The association must provide at least 45 days written notice before recording a claim of lien for unpaid assessments.
Specific requirement: Provide 45 days written notice before recording claim of lien
Penalty for Non-Compliance
Lien may be invalid if proper notice was not given
How to Verify Compliance
- Review your CC&Rs and bylaws for a provision explicitly addressing this requirement.
- Confirm the governing documents specify a notice period of at least 45 days (not fewer).
